What is a pay stub generator?

A pay stub generator is a tool that formats payroll figures — earnings, deductions, and net pay — into a clean, printable document. Instead of laying out a table by hand every pay period, you enter the numbers once and the tool handles the structure, math, and formatting. This generator runs entirely in your browser: there's no account to create and no data sent anywhere, so it works equally well for a small business owner running payroll for a handful of employees, a freelancer documenting their own income, or anyone who needs a clear record of a pay period.

What is gross pay?

Gross pay is the total amount earned in a pay period before anything is subtracted. It's the sum of every earning line — regular hours, overtime, bonuses, commissions, and any other pay — added together. This generator totals your gross pay automatically as you fill in the earnings section.

What are deductions?

Deductions are amounts subtracted from gross pay before an employee receives their earnings. Common examples include income tax withholding, social security or equivalent contributions, health insurance premiums, and retirement plan contributions. Because tax rules and required deductions vary so widely between countries, states, and provinces, this tool does not calculate them for you — you enter the exact figures that apply to your situation, and the tool totals them transparently.

What is net pay?

Net pay, sometimes called take-home pay, is what's left after subtracting total deductions from gross pay. It's the amount actually paid to the employee for that period, and this generator displays it prominently on the pay stub so it's easy to find at a glance.

What is YTD pay?

YTD, or year-to-date, figures track cumulative totals from the start of the calendar (or fiscal) year through the current pay period — typically YTD gross pay, YTD taxes, YTD deductions, and YTD net pay. Including YTD totals on a pay stub gives a running picture of earnings and withholding across the year, not just the current period. This section is optional and can be hidden if it isn't needed.
